What should I consider when planning a bathroom renovation in Denver?

When planning your bathroom renovation in Denver, it’s important to consider local building codes and permit requirements, especially for plumbing and electrical updates. Additionally, factoring in the climate can help choose suitable materials and ensure proper insulation to prevent moisture issues. Working with a local contractor familiar with Denver regulations can streamline the process and help keep your project on schedule.

How long does a typical bathroom renovation take?

The duration of a bathroom renovation can vary based on the scope of work, but generally, it takes between two to four weeks. Factors such as the extent of demolition, custom tile work, plumbing rerouting, or electrical updates can influence the timeline. An experienced contractor can provide a more precise estimate tailored to your specific renovation plan.

Do I need permits for my bathroom remodel in Denver?

Yes, typically permits are required for significant plumbing, electrical, or structural changes in Denver. It’s advisable to check with local authorities or your remodeling professional to ensure all necessary permits are obtained before starting construction, helping you avoid potential fines or project delays.

Bathroom Renovation cost in Denver

Across Denver, Bathroom Renovation typically runs $9,600–$28,800 in 2026. It is scaled to Denver's home values. Exact pricing depends on materials, fixture choices, and the scope of work. full bathroom renovations require permits for plumbing, electrical, and sometimes structural work; a licensed contractor pulls them.

The Bathroom Renovation process in Denver

What a Denver Bathroom Renovation project actually involves: gut demolition to studs, rough plumbing and electrical, waterproofing, all tile and finish work, new vanity, tub or shower, toilet, fixtures, and final inspection. Denver County Bathroom Renovation Market Context

Denver County has a 50% owner / 50% renter split (U.S. Census ACS 2021). Mixed-tenure markets see both owner-directed upgrades and landlord turnover renovations — steady demand for licensed remodelers across project tiers.

Why bath remodels spike here: Denver County has had 4 major FEMA disaster declarations since 1990 including Flood events (most recent: 2020). Water events are a top driver of unplanned bathroom remodeling — insurance-covered remediation frequently leads to full fixture and tile replacement while walls are already open, and contractor lead times in affected counties can stretch 6–18 months. Source: FEMA OpenFEMA, 1990–2024.
